Background
The four-roller crusher is a middle-crushing fine crusher with simple and compact structure, portability and reliability, can be used for crushing limestone, argillaceous shale, marl, chalk, bricks, slag, clinker, feldspar, coke and the like, and has the yield which is changed according to different compression strengths of materials.
CN202983758U discloses a four-roller crusher, the both ends of going up driven roll and lower driven roll all set up in the frame through movable bearing seat horizontal slip, through the round trip movement of pneumatic cylinder control movable bearing seat, but offer the groove of moving in top usually on the lateral wall of movable bearing seat, the horizontal depth in groove is 32mm, causes the wall of this department of movable bearing seat thin, and easy damage influences the normal operating of machine.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without any creative effort belong to the protection scope of the present invention.
As shown in fig. 1-5, a four-roll crusher comprises a frame 1, wherein a feed inlet 2 is arranged at the upper end of the frame 1, an upper driving roll 3 and an upper driven roll 4 which are parallel to each other are arranged in the frame 1, a lower driven roll 5 is arranged below the upper driving roll 3, a lower driving roll 6 is arranged below the upper driven roll 4, two ends of the upper driven roll 4 and two ends of the lower driven roll 5 are horizontally and slidably arranged on the frame 1 through movable bearing seats 7, two ends of the upper driving roll 3 and two ends of the lower driving roll 6 are both arranged on the frame 1 through fixed bearing seats, one end of the upper driving roll 3 is connected with an upper driving mechanism 8, the other end of the upper driving roll is provided with an upper wedge belt wheel 9, and the upper wedge belt wheel 9 drives the lower driven roll 5 through a multi; one end of the lower driving roller 6 is connected with a lower driving mechanism 11, the other end is provided with a lower wedge belt wheel 12, the lower wedge belt wheel 12 drives the upper driven roller 4 through a poly-wedge belt 10, a tension device 13 is arranged on a transmission path of the poly-wedge belt 10, and the tension device 13 is arranged on the frame 1. An electric roller skin cutting device 14 is arranged at one side of the frame 1 and is used for turning when the surface of the roller is partially worn. The upper driving mechanism 8 and the lower driving mechanism 11 both comprise a motor 15, a speed reducer 16 and a coupler 17 which are sequentially connected, and are connected with the upper driving roller 3 or the lower driving roller 6 through the coupler 17. The fixed bearing seat and the movable bearing seat 7 are both connected with a centralized lubricating system.
The outside of movable bearing seat 7 is fixed with connecting seat 18 through the bolt, is provided with in the connecting seat 18 and pushes up movable groove 19, and the one end that pushes up movable groove 19 towards movable bearing seat 7 is the open end, has horizontally pneumatic cylinder 20 through the bolt fastening on the frame 1 in the connecting seat 18 outside, and the piston rod of pneumatic cylinder 20 slides and passes connecting seat 18, and arranges in and pushes up movable groove 19, and the working end of piston rod has top 21 through the bolt fastening, and top 21 is the arc towards the one end of movable bearing seat 7. The outer side of the movable bearing seat 7 is provided with a positioning groove 22 corresponding to the position of the jacking groove 19, and the horizontal depth of the positioning groove 22 is 5 mm. Four hydraulic cylinders 20 are connected to the hydraulic station.
The application method of the embodiment comprises the following steps: install frame 1 on the chassis is, the chassis is fixed subaerial through rag bolt, actuating mechanism 8 and lower actuating mechanism 11 are gone up in the start simultaneously, send into the material through feed inlet 2 and carry out primary crushing between last drive roll 3 and the last driven roll 4, then fall into down and carry out secondary crushing between driven roll 5 and the lower drive roll 6, according to the big or small demand of product granularity, or when getting into difficult broken object or unexpected reason and leading to equipment to transship, all pass through the flexible adjustment of pneumatic cylinder 20 on drive roll 3 and last driven roll 4 between, the interval between lower driven roll 5 and the lower drive roll 6.
